D.5. PFTP Daemon Stanza
A large number of options are available for configuring the PFTP daemon and tuning its
performance. These options were previously specified in the ftpaccess file or via command line
switches. These options have now been consolidated into the PFTP daemon stanza in t he HPSS.conf
file. The options are described below:
